##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 1.64:1 — AA fail, AA-large fail,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#1e8572 (4.51:1); AA: background → #545454 (4.61:1); AAA: text → #176456 (7.01:1); AAA: background → #383838 (7.13:1)
- On black (#000000): 12.78: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A pass
